Default Anything wrong with these kits?

Looking for a 550/600 bare bone kit.

Have a SK-720BE/GPS-1 combo with HV servo setup, just looking for a kit that is decent and not too expensive to throw around this season while learning the Skookum system. Pickings for decent barebone in the 500/550/600 sizes are slim (I think due to drones being more popular at the present time).

RCMart has the Innova TDT 550 @$199.99 and 600 @$229.99 otherwise known as V2 or FBL.

http://www.myrcmart.com/kds-innova-5...py-p-4087.html

http://www.myrcmart.com/kds-innova-6...py-p-4091.html.

Anything wrong with these birds? Not looking for a $1000 Corvette, just a decent frame to learn the SK-720BE/GPS without breaking the bank.

I see parts might be a an issue, but for $200...I'll just buy a second frame as a crash kit

Ask Atomic Skull, I think he's got an Innova.

The Chase at least is great, and I've heard the Agile 5.5 is not bad but the 7.2 tends to eat belts.

BTW you don't need a big machine to try the 720. The Chase has a pretty big area for mounting the flybarless system, though you might have to put the GPS on the boom.

Quote:
Originally Posted by helitrue View Post
innova is an old series the pinion mesh must be set up right

The V2 injection moulded maingears are stronger than the original ones. They also have almost no wobble or runout. I have an 11T pinion and a small amount of backlash set on my Innova 700 and it survives hard full collective pitch pumps with no problems.
